Ingredients

  • 2 Tbsp. Salted Butter
  • 2 Tbsp. Roasted Garlic Oil
  • 2 Tbsp. Minced Garlic
  • Salt & Pepper
  • 2 Cans Ranch Style Beans, Pinto Beans, or Chili Beans
  • ¾ Cup Enchilada Sauce
  • ⅓ Cup Sour Cream
  • 2 Cups Grated Cheddar Jack Cheese
  • diced tomatoes
  • diced onion
  • cilantro
  • sliced avocado
  • grated cheese
  • Frito or Tortilla Chips

Directions

  1. Preheat the broiler
  2. In an ovenproof skillet heat butter over medium heat. Add the onion and garlic. Season with salt and pepper, and cook until softened and translucent, 2 to 3 minutes. Mash the beans with the back od a fork.
  3. Fold in the sour cream and ½ cup of cheddar jack cheese. Mix well and top with the remaining 1 ½ cups cheddar jack cheese.
  4. Broil the dip until the cheese starts to brown and bubbe, 3 to 4 minutes.
  5. Garnish with tomato, onion, cilantro, avocado, cheese, and sour cream.
  6. Serve hot with tortilla or frito chips.
